Flutter vs React Native: Choosing the Right Mobile Development Framework
Introduction to Cross-Platform Development
With the proliferation of mobile devices, developers and companies are on a constant quest to simplify the app development process. Cross-platform frameworks like Flutter and React Native have emerged as popular solutions, allowing developers to use a single codebase for both iOS and Android platforms. But which one should you choose for your next project?
Overview of Flutter
What is Flutter?
Flutter is an open-source UI software development toolkit created by Google. It allows developers to build natively compiled applications for mobile, web, and desktop from a single codebase. Its language of choice is Dart, which compiles into native machine code.
Advantages of Flutter
- Fast Development: Flutter's "hot reload" feature allows developers to see changes in real time, reducing debugging time significantly.
- Expressive and Flexible UI: Flutter offers a rich set of customizable widgets that adhere to both Material Design and Cupertino standards.
- Strong Community Support: While relatively new, Flutter has gained rapid popularity, and its community provides extensive support and resources.
Challenges with Flutter
- Learning Curve: Developers need to learn Dart, which might be unfamiliar to those used to JavaScript or other languages.
- App Size: Flutter apps tend to have larger file sizes, which might be a concern for certain applications.
Overview of React Native
What is React Native?
React Native, developed by Facebook, is a popular framework for building mobile applications using JavaScript and React. It allows developers to build mobile apps with a true native feel by providing a set of components that map directly to native UI building blocks.
Advantages of React Native
- JavaScript Usage: Leverages JavaScript, one of the most widely used programming languages, making it accessible to a wide range of developers.
- Rich Ecosystem: React Native benefits from a robust ecosystem and numerous third-party libraries, speeding up the development process.
- Large Community: As a mature framework, React Native has a large, active community offering plentiful resources and troubleshooting aid.
Challenges with React Native
- Performance Issues: React Native can face performance bottlenecks, particularly for highly complex animations and advanced graphics.
- Limited Customization: While React Native provides a native look and feel, it can be restrictive in terms of fully customizing UI components.
Performance Comparison
Performance is a critical factor in mobile app development. Flutter's direct compilation to native code often results in better performance in comparison to React Native, which relies on a JavaScript bridge. This is particularly advantageous for apps requiring heavy animations or graphics. However, React Native can excel in applications where JavaScript's flexibility and a wide range of libraries are beneficial.
Development Experience
Developer experience varies between the two frameworks. Flutter's hot reload and modular architecture provide a seamless experience for rapid prototyping. However, React Native's JavaScript foundation can attract developers already familiar with web development, albeit with potential challenges in debugging and performance tuning.
Conclusion: Which Framework to Choose?
Choosing between Flutter and React Native largely depends on your team's expertise, project requirements, and long-term goals. If rapid development and a robust UI are priorities, and you're open to learning Dart, Flutter might be the right choice. Conversely, if you prefer to leverage existing JavaScript skills and benefit from a mature ecosystem, React Native could be more advantageous.
Ultimately, both frameworks are powerful tools in the modern developer's toolkit, enabling the creation of high-quality cross-platform applications.
